Transaction 1e66384fbbc9694eda29ced410969389bbfecedcd2e40ff212869802ff2c475d

3 Input
2 Outputs
  • 1e66384fbbc9694eda29ced410969389bbfecedcd2e40ff212869802ff2c475d:0
  • value  590958
    address  1Ee1VagCC7tWyVvJPKbqkxBXaPefKHffPx
  • 1e66384fbbc9694eda29ced410969389bbfecedcd2e40ff212869802ff2c475d:1
  • value  1475068
    address  1K2cAPa37kkqDUpp5RzDFY6orimV72LYzr